Bomber. Pours a hazy light gold with a tall head that sticks around for a while. The aroma is tame and slightly musty, though provides some zestiness and wheaty notes. The mouthfeel is light and fairly fizzy, though refreshing. Fokker is pretty clean and has tiny hints at fruity esters and almost something like grapefruit and lemons. Everything is very light, but nicely done especially considering the style.

Bomber. Awesome looking bottle with a great, simple design of a 50’s style Marilyn Monroe looking girl. The beer’s a golden copper color, clear, big soapy head that disappears quickly. Very sour, lemony nose with some nice bready malts. I get a hint of sourdough bread, lemons, and sharp carbonation. This brew comes across more like a thin Belgian dubbel than what you’d expect out of a small brewery’s attempt at a usually boring, watery style. This is the best golden or blonde I’ve had to date.
